| Abstract: | Researchers have sought ways to measure the benefits of various Human resource practices. One measurement schema comes from Watson Wyatt, who has developed a mathematical model that demonstrates a clear relationship between certain human capital practices and increased shareholder value. The value-creating practices have been grouped into the following six factors: total rewards and accountability; collegial, flexible workplace, recruiting and retention excellence; communications integrity; focused HR service technologies; and prudent use of resources. |
